Cholesterol is a fatty-waxy substance found in the bloodstream. This fatty substance is vital for creating cell membranes, hormones, and vitamin D. However, bear in mind that having an excess of low-density lipoprotein (LDL), commonly referred to as ‘bad’ cholesterol, could put you at risk of heart disease. In males, elevated cholesterol levels often don’t produce apparent symptoms, making it hard to notice. But a few unexpected changes, especially in the eyes, might hint at high LDL cholesterol levels. Yellow Deposits Around the Eyes

A prominent symptom of high LDL cholesterol in men appears as yellow deposits around the eye. These yellowish patches or xanthelasma materialize on the eyelid’s inner corners, not causing any pain or discomfort but serving as an overt marker of increased cholesterol levels.

White Ring Formation Around Cornea

Arcus senilis condition results in a white or grey ring around the cornea of the eye caused by cholesterol deposition. While it’s common in the elderly, it can also signal high cholesterol levels, particularly in men. If younger men exhibit arcus senilis, it could need further scrutiny of cholesterol levels.

Grey Ring Formation Near Cornea

The corneal arcus, akin to arcus senilis, is when a white or light-grey ring forms around the eye’s cornea. It’s another condition linked to high blood cholesterol. Subtle but significant, corneal arcus can point to possible cardiovascular risk factors, such as high LDL cholesterol.

Blurry Vision

High LDL cholesterol can trigger cholesterol build-up in the eye’s blood vessels, potentially impacting retina blood flow and hence vision. Men ridden with high LDL cholesterol might experience blurred vision or difficulty focusing due to cholesterol-induced eye health deterioration.

Vision Distortions

Blockage of the retina’s blood vessels, termed retinal vein occlusion, can cause vision loss or distortions. Several factors could cause it, including high cholesterol, particularly LDL. Men experiencing sudden vision alterations or vision loss should immediately seek medical attention to rule out severe conditions such as retinal vein occlusion.
